Just off the top of my head, the last major Atlantic hurricane ot occur during July was 115 mph Bertha in 1996....which later struck North Carolina as a cat-2 (100-105 mph & 974 mb).
The last major hurricane to make landfall in the U.S. during July was way back in 1936, when a small 115 mph cat-3 (963 mb) struck the Florida panhandle on July 30-31.
The only other major hurricane to strike the U.S. during July occurred in 1916...a cat-3 (125-130 mph/ 948 mb) that struck the Mississippi/ Alabama coast on July 4th.....and caused massive flooding throughout the deep south.
There have been cat-2 landfalling hurricanes during July in North Carolina (Bertha)....NE Florida near Cape Canaveral (1926)....and several along the Gulf Coast from the Florida panhandle westward to Texas -- but NO landfalling U.S. hurricane in July has ever been as intense as Audrey (cat-4 140 mph) in June 1957..
